Armed Intruder Fatally Shot by Secret Service at Trump's Mar-a-Lago Residence

An armed individual was fatally shot by U.S. Secret Service agents after breaching the perimeter of former President Donald Trump's Mar-a-Lago residence in Florida. The incident occurred when the intruder illegally entered the protected area of the property.

Details of the Incident

According to the Secret Service, the man, estimated to be around 20 years old, was carrying a canister of gasoline. Agents confronted the intruder after he bypassed security measures and entered the restricted zone.

A press conference was scheduled for 9:00 AM with representatives from the FBI and Palm Beach County to provide further details. The Secret Service stated that the identity of the deceased would not be released until his next of kin had been notified.

Confrontation and Fatal Shooting

Sheriff Rick Bradshaw later confirmed that the armed man attempted to resist arrest. He was spotted by a sergeant and two security agents. When confronted, the intruder was ordered to drop the canister and his firearm.

While the man complied with dropping the gasoline canister, he prepared to fire his weapon. At this point, the sergeant and Secret Service agents opened fire, neutralizing the threat.

The investigation is ongoing, with the FBI leading the inquiry and receiving full cooperation from local authorities. Mar-a-Lago, located in Florida, is the private residence of the 45th and 47th U.S. President, Donald Trump, and has been considered the family's permanent home since November 2019.

This event follows a recent assassination attempt on Donald Trump during a campaign rally in Pennsylvania in July 2024.
